Warning Signs You Need After Hours Water Removal

Don’t ignore the warning signs of water damage. Catching it early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ong musty odors can show that your property has been damaged by water. If you notice a persistent sm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call us. Our technicians will assess the damage and create a customized plan to extract the water and dry out your space.

After Hours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
You notice a small leak under your sink. Yes No It’s a simple fix that you can handle on your own.
You have a large area of standing water in your basement. No Yes It’s a safety hazard and needs specialized equipment to extract the water.
You notice a musty odor in your attic. No Yes It could show a larger issue with water damage that needs professional attention.
You have a small area of water damage from a burst pipe. Maybe No It’s a relatively small area and you might be able to handle it on your own, but it’s always best to consult a professional to ensure the damage is fully addressed.
You have a large area of water damage from a flood. No Yes It’s a safety hazard and needs specialized equipment to extract the water and dry out your property.

After Hours Water Removal Cost In Century Village, FL

The cost of After Hours Water Removal in Century Village, FL, will depend on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our prices range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the specific needs of your property. We’ll work closely with you to ensure that you understand the costs and that you’re getting the best value for your money.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age.
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the level of moisture.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$100 – $500 The level of contamination and the size of the affected area.
Equipment Rental $50 – $200 The type and size of the equipment needed.
Insurance Claims Help $0 – $500 The level of help needed and the complexity of the claims process.

The prices listed above are estimates and may vary depending on the specific needs of your property. We’ll work closely with you to ensure that you understand the costs and that you’re getting the best value for your money.
